PPC (pay-per-click) is an advertising model where businesses pay a fee for every click on their ad. This model allows businesses to only pay for actual engagement with their ad, rather than simply paying for impressions. With PPC, advertisers have more control over their ad spend and can track the effectiveness of their campaigns.
To appear on top of SERPs (search engine results pages), advertisers must bid on ad placement. Advertisers compete by offering the highest bid for a specific keyword or target audience. Higher bids increase the chances of appearing at the top of the search results and gaining more visibility.
To effectively bid for ad placement, advertisers need to conduct thorough keyword research and identify the most relevant keywords for their target audience. It is important to choose keywords with high search volume and low competition to increase the chances of getting the desired ad placement.

Tracking URLs and analyzing metrics are vital for improving the effectiveness of PPC campaigns. By using tracking URLs, advertisers can track the source of clicks and identify which ads are driving the most traffic. This information can be used to optimize the campaign by focusing on the most effective keywords and ad placements.
Metrics such as click-through rate, conversion rate, and cost per conversion provide insights into the performance of the campaign. Advertisers should regularly analyze these metrics to identify areas for improvement and make data-driven decisions to optimize their PPC campaigns.

Interstitial ads are a popular form of mobile advertising that cover the entire screen of a mobile device. They can appear when opening a page or browsing between pages or apps. These ads have a high-impact visual experience and are effective in grabbing the user’s attention. However, it is important for advertisers to be cautious and not interrupt the user’s browsing experience excessively. This can result in negative user experiences.

In addition to interstitial and video ads, there are other mobile ad formats that advertisers can consider.
Expandable ads: typically start with a size of 320×50 pixels and increase to 320×480 pixels after a tap. These ads allow for more interactive content and can display additional information about a product or service.
Standard banner ads: have a horizontal shape and commonly come in sizes of 320×50 or 300×50 pixels. These ads are commonly seen at the top or bottom of mobile screens and are a cost-effective way to increase brand visibility.
Native ads: are integrated into the content and do not take up the entire screen. They blend seamlessly with the app or website’s design, providing a more natural and non-intrusive user experience. Native ads are often perceived as more trustworthy and can lead to higher engagement rates.
